    As for the game itself, like any good MMORPG it copies a lot from previous MMOs. WoW players will be at home in it, although there's some key differences.

    -2 factions, Guardian and Defiant. Guardians are religious dorks and defiant are steampunk dorks.

    -There's 4 archetype "callings", and each one has 8 "souls" that you can assign 3 at a time. It's like WoW's talent trees except you can mix stuff up a lot more.
    Like rogue has something like: Assassin, Elemental-type dude, swashbuckler, tank (yes rly), bard, and so on.
    PIC IS RELATED


    -The namesake of the game, Rifts, open up a lot and create invasions of various towns and outposts and crap. It's quite awesome. The vast majority of the rewards you get from this stuff is directly related to your contribution to closing it and as such the loot isn't shared, which helps a lot. Oh yeah, you automatically form teams for most of this stuff, which is a nice bonus.
